Under contract-accepting backup offers. Over the river and through the woods to your Florida country paradise! Brand New Well pump for the Artisanal Well, Roof 2011, HVAC 2023, w/h is newer but unsure of age. This country home fixer-upper is ready for its next owner to bring it back to life and make it home. Located in a private river-access neighborhood, the property includes access to the neighborhood boat ramp and a dock on the St. Johns River — perfect for fishing, boating, evening/ early morning strolls and enjoying the Florida lifestyle. Situated on a half-acre lot, the home features approximately 1,400 sq. ft. of living space with 3 bedrooms, 2 bathrooms, and a utility/laundry room. The property also offers a large detached 2-car garage with water and electric, a workshop area in the back, and a covered side patio. There is plenty of room to park your toys, store equipment, or create your dream garden. Scope of work required includes new well pump and plumbing (home has galvanized steel that needs replaced), new flooring needed, paint, and updating to taste. Additional highlights include an artesian well serving the property and an X flood zone designation.
